Axcelis Technologies Inc designs, manufactures, and services ion implantation and other processing equipment used in the fabrication of semiconductor chips. In addition to equipment, the company provides aftermarket lifecycle products and services, including used tools, spare parts, equipment upgrades, maintenance services, and customer training. Geographically, the group has a business presence in North America, Asia Pacific, and Europe, of which key revenue is derived from the Asia Pacific.
Mirion Technologies Inc provides products, services, and software that allow customers to safely leverage the power of ionizing radiation for applications that benefit the health, safety, vitality, and technological progress of the human experience. The Company manages its operations through two segments: Nuclear & Safety and Medical. The Medical segment improves the quality and safety of cancer care delivery and supports applications across medical diagnostics and practitioner safety. The Nuclear & Safety segment powers advancements in nuclear energy and critical radiation safety, measurement and analysis applications across laboratories, research and other industrial markets such as defense.
